Guiding image segmentation with edge information is an often
employed strategy in low level computer vision.
To improve the trade-off between the sensitivity of homogeneous region
delineation and the oversegmentation of the image, we have
incorporated a recently proposed edge magnitude/confidence map
into a color image segmenter based on the mean shift procedure.
The new method can recover
regions with weak but sharp boundaries and thus can provide
a more accurate input for high level interpretation modules.
The Edge Detection and Image SegmentatiON (EDISON) system,
available for download, implements the proposed technique and
provides a complete toolbox for discontinuity preserving filtering,
segmentation and edge detection.
